Summary:
- This article discusses the consensus among economists regarding the reality and severity of climate change. Economists generally agree that climate change is a significant threat that requires urgent action to address.
- The article highlights a survey of leading economists, which found that over 90% of respondents believe climate change is a serious problem that should be addressed through policy measures such as carbon pricing.
- The article emphasizes the importance of economists' voices in the climate change debate, as they can provide valuable insights into the economic impacts and potential solutions to this global challenge.
